If you’re a Star Wars fan, chances are you’re intrigued by the dynamic between the evil Darth Vader and his estranged Jedi Knight son Luke Skywalker. Once Luke learns of his paternity, of course, he’s shocked and left in disbelief. After he comes to terms with the news, Luke wants to “save” his father from the Dark Side.
But what if Darth Vader hadn’t been separated from his son at birth and he actually was able to take part in raising the young Skywalker? That’s the journey Darth Vader and Son, a new hardcover picture book in the Star Wars Chronicle series, takes us on. And what a sweet one it is.
The Jim Henson Company is responsible for the greatest puppet creations of all time, and they’re still going very strong. When word came that they would be heavily involved in the massive return of the Muppets as well as other puppet-related titles like a Dark Crystal sequel and a Fraggle Rock movie, we the children of the ’80s were elated.
While the various Muppet/puppet movies are still in development, other forms of entertainment are on the way to re-ignite an interest and an excitement in these worlds and the characters within them. One example of this is the brand new Fraggle Rock comic book by Jeffrey Brown that’s currently set for release in April. Fans will also have the chance to grab some Fraggle action when an issue is available during the beloved Free Comic Day.
Those of you who can’t wait will be happy to discover that MTV was able to get their hands on some goodies from the new series, including a look at the first cover and a sample of the Free Comic Book Day offering.
